Creating Linked Data from a Large Community site

Posted by brucewhealtonjr on July 3, 2011 at 7:14am

Hello,
I was wanting to produce RDF files for each member of a large online community of writers. It is using Drupal 7, so it has RDFa and many vocabularies "out of the box." I might want to add doac (description of a career), vcard RDF vocab, and perhaps bio.
I don't know if it is possible to go in now and create a file structure for holding data files that relate to each person. For example, starting with FOAF, I'd want to have a folders structure such as:
[username]/foaf.rdf
or better yet:
[user's real name/foaf.rdf

Drupal, The Semantic Web and Genealogy

Posted by brucewhealtonjr on June 17, 2011 at 7:29pm

Hello all,
I would like to develop a genealogy application in Drupal. I wanted to see what has already been done specifically as it relates to using the Semantic Web. I know there are some genealogy modules but I'm interested in this from a Semantic Web perspective. I know that Drupal 7 supports RDFa out of the box, as it were. However, for Genealogy there are two specific vocabularies (at least) that one would want to use for Genealogy, that being BIO for biographic information and it has a focus around events in one's life.
